Mikita Badziakouski Doubles Through Ali Imsirovic

With the board reading [Jh4h5s9c6d] and approximately 200,000 in the middle, Ali Imsirovic moved all-in, having Mikita Badziakouski covered. Badziakouski used a time extension and called all-in for 462,000, tabling [AcAs]. Imsirovic tabled [Th8d] for a missed straight draw, and Badziakouski doubled.
